into the secret of life.« Of all
the varieties of tarot we find Thoth tarot the most fascinating. It was
conceived by Aleister Crowley and designed and painted by Frieda Harris.
It is our experience that this is the only collection of tarot cards that takes
into consideration numerology, astrology, alchemy and kabala. It contains
symbolic traditions of many cultures: Egyptian, Mediaeval and Christian. What
fascinates us most is the quality of artistic realization, comparative
symbolism and excellent interpretation of Jung's psychodynamics. What is tarot? »Tarot

approaches our soul. It is reflected in dreams and contemplative states. The Origin of Tarot The
origin of tarot cards is unknown. Metaphysics teachers often refer to ancient
Egyptian and Hermetic magic schools but the first so far discovered packs of
cards were either Egyptian or European. A Pack of Tarot Cards A pack
contains 78 cards and consists of the major and minor archana. · Minor archana is divided into four
so-called suits (Swords, Cups, Staves and
Disks) and at the same time contains the Court Symbols. In every suit there are
14 cards from Ace to Ten, Knight, Queen, Prince and Princess. · Major archana consists of zero and
Roman numerals from I to XXI. The Major archana reveals the principle of life, common laws and experiences that all
humans go through. Similarly to I Ching, the Eastern book of Changes, tarot is a western book of changes.
While the hexagrams of I Ching present changes in literary and natural
metaphors, tarot is their visual illustration. More info: Shana Flogie +386 41 410 176 This e-mail address is being protected from spam bots, you need JavaScript enabled to view it |
